Given:-
Amount of current drawn = 0.5 A
Time for which current drawn = 6 hours = 6 × 3600 = 21600 seconds
To find :-
The amount of charge flow in the circuit.
Solution:-
Let the amount of charge flow in circuit will be Q.
Form current formula,
I = Q / T
also,
Q = I * T
Q =
hence,the amount of charge flow in circuit will be 1.08 × 10^5 Columb.
